Rare and highly desirable 1957 Gibson ES-5 Switchmaster in original blonde finish.A true golden-era Gibson archtop featuring the classic 3-pickup configuration with its original P-90 pickups, delivering the open, woody and articulate tone that defines the finest 1950s Gibson hollow bodies.This example has an especially elegant and resonant acoustic response, paired with a notably slim neck profile that feels remarkably fast and comfortable for a guitar of this era — a feature many modern players and collectors actively seek out.The guitar appears largely original and presents beautifully with honest vintage wear and natural patina throughout.SpecificationsYear: 1957Finish: Original BlondePickups: 3 original Gibson P-90 pickupsNeck profile: Slim and fast-playingConstruction: Fully hollow laminated maple archtopCondition / NotesMissing original pickguardTuners have been replaced with Schaller tunersSold with older non-original hard caseOtherwise a highly original and well-preserved exampleThe blonde ES-5 Switchmaster models surface far less frequently than their sunburst counterparts and remain among the more visually striking and sonically complex Gibson archtops of the 1950s.An exceptional instrument equally suited for the serious collector, studio player, or professional jazz guitarist seeking a top-tier vintage Gibson with both aesthetic presence and tonal depth.Located in Denmark.
